AI Summary

  • Adds new funding allocation for Department of Military and Veterans Affairs to administer recreation passport fee programs, capped at $1,000,000 annually for the first 3 years and $500,000 annually thereafter

  • Changes revenue distribution formula based on participation rate: if less than 55% of registered vehicles pay the recreation passport fee, 80% of remaining revenue goes to state park improvement account; if 55% or more participate, only 70% goes to state parks

  • Increases local public recreation facilities fund allocation from 10% to 20% of remaining revenue when participation rate reaches 55% or higher

  • Eliminates previous separate allocations of 50% for capital improvements and 30% for operations/maintenance, combining them into single percentages based on participation thresholds

  • Takes effect October 1, 2026 and requires Department of State to report annual participation rates by August 1 each year

Legislative Description

Recreation: state parks; recreation passport fee; modify revenue distribution formula. Amends sec. 2045 of 1994 PA 451 (MCL 324.2045).
